Why take echinacea?

0

Main uses of echinacea • Reduces the time taken to get rid of the common cold and may also help with prevention • Helps with minor infections • May help prevent herpes simplex (cold sores) • Useful in treating upper repiratory problems • Can help with skin regeneration and skin infections • Yeast infections (candida) • Athlete’s foot If taking Echinacea to help prevent the common cold, it is suggested that you take it as soon as you first notice the symptoms. Echinacea should be taken for approximately two weeks at a time.
